Software is as critical as hardware: The UHK supports holding a key down to select a different keymap layer, then using the other hand to tap a key in that layer. While few people learn many-key chording, "one finger each hand" is every bit as easy as ordinary typing, with practice. This supports an n^2 expansion in effective keyboard reach. I'm surprised this isn't the norm for selecting Chinese/Japanese characters.
The question is: How well? I'm not entirely happy with my QMK firmware implementation. Tap-hold is the antithesis of n-key rollover; one needs to learn to properly nest key-down, key-up events. It's easy to switch from a clarinet (cleanly cover holes) to a saxophone (slap pads), but hard switching back. And we've all learned to type like we're on a saxophone, relying on n-key rollover to cover many sins.
I now use QMK firmware with Hasu controllers for multiple Leopold FC660C keyboards with Topre Silent 45g "rubber dome" key switches. After trying dozens of mechanical key switches, I found that nothing feels like a Topre switch.
And here's the kicker: The physical form factor doesn't matter so much if your fingers rarely go far from home row, which is what tap/hold facilitates.

#55This is beautiful. I'm a "Let's Split" style keyboarder as well so this made me giddy! There's a distinct lack of solid cases out there for this layout style. You mention possibly mass producing the next round. Please add a notify email list or something. I'd be all over this.
The plastic laminate of my ergodoxen was stiff, sturdy, and heavy. The exposed bolts were a little industrial. Very much had a DIY look.
My Lily58 started out with the PCB "case" which is horrible. Way too flexible, and switches falling out as soon as you attempted to transport it. (Easy transport was my main motivation for the smaller keyboard.)
Eventually, I was able to convince someone on Etsy to print me a 3d case for it. It is ok. Much better than the PCBs. However, switches still have a tendency to pop out when moving the keyboard.
The case on the Bayleaf makes me wonder if other keyboards could do a better job with case offerings.

#56Why do no split keyboards have symbols on the keycaps? What happens when you forget where a key is that you don't use often, do you just have to press keys until you find it again?
The other thing is that many keys will have multiple functions - so what do you print on them? e.g. my j key also doubles as # and the down key. Some are maybe even more frequently used key combinations, e.g. I have a ``` and a => key
